#2a5231 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2a5231 is composed of 16.5% red, 32.2%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.2% yellow and 67.8% black. It has a hue angle of 130.5 degrees, a saturation of 32.3% and a lightness of 24.3%. #2a5231 color hex could be obtained by blending #54a462 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#2a5231

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020402 is the darkest color, while #f6faf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2a5231

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d3f3d is the less saturated color, while #047818 is the most saturated one.
